Running XP Pro. After a few minutes on the web, I get a
message that NT AUTHORITY/ SYSTEM Remote Procedure Call
service terminated unexpectedly. I have been trying to
get Windows Update packs but keep getting cut-off.

* Turn on your firewall
* Go to windows update (http://windowsupdate.microsoft.com) and install all
critical updates. You don't have to download the other updates if you don't
want to, but "Critical" means what it says.
* Update your virus scanner and do a full scan of your system
* Consider turning on automatic windows updates, or get into the habit of
visiting windows update on a regular basis.

Apparently, your computer has an unwelcome visitor (VIRUS) known=20
as the WM32 Blaster/Lovsan WORM.

It entered the computer through your internet connection because the =
"firewall"
was not properly enabled and essential critical updates were not =
installed from
the Windows Update website. For instructions on fixing the problem, =
visit:

If your computer is constantly attempting to shutdown
or reboot, quickly go to:

Start > Run and type: CMD , and hit enter.
This opens the Command Prompt window.

Then type: shutdown -a , and hit enter.

This should halt the rebooting problem.

Then immediately turn-on Windows XP's built-in Firewall:
